These applicants applied for one of our homes on 2/9/24, and they stated on their application that they would be able to provide a cosigner at that time. The application did not meet all of our criteria to be approved, therefore we required a cosigner. The criteria that were not met was:
2 years of established credit history
A previous judgement with a landlord
2 years of verifiable rental history
Our policies for the application and approval process are clearly listed on our website, there was no discrimination against these applicants. We informed them of the final determination of requiring a cosigner and then they called our office requesting their application fees of $50 be refunded - these are non-refundable fees which is also clearly stated on our website.
As far as building credit history, any tenant of ours will have their monthly rent payments reported to a credit bureau which can help build credit history. If they provide a qualified cosigner, they would be able to move forward with the home and could also build credit.
